It's a bittersweet time as we get closer and closer to George Strait's final concert of his career on June 7 at AT&T Stadium in Arlington.

The country music legend and one of the most famous Texans of all-time is about to grace the stage for his final performance, but there will be plenty of fanfare leading up to it.

Iconic Texas magazine Texas Monthly released photos of the cover of its June issue with The King on the cover, and it's ... well, perfect.

It's beautiful, isn't it? We've seen the pictures of George with his hand over his heart as he acknowledges his fans and showcases his appreciation. It's an image that Texas Monthly immortalized perfectly.

This cover is actually one of two, and subscribers will receive the above cover in the mail, or if you order online right here.

If you buy it at the newsstand you'll get a cover with the same picture, but it has some text added.
